Job Summary

Join a 10-week Summer Internship Program as a Cybersecurity Analyst in Enterprise Technology Services. Help protect American Express information systems and digital assets by supporting security operations such as monitoring alerts and logs, triaging incidents, and assisting with secure network, endpoint, identity, and access management activities. Collaborate across cybersecurity, software development, operations, and business teams while learning how security controls are integrated into the software development lifecycle, including secure development practices and documentation.

Key Responsibilities

  • •Support monitoring of security systems and events using tools, alerts, and logs to identify threats and vulnerabilities.
  • •Triage and investigate security or operational issues to determine root causes, impacts, and mitigation strategies.
  • •Support secure network, endpoint, identity, and access management activities with guidance from peers and leaders.
  • •Assist with security documentation, assessment findings, remediation tracking, and reporting to improve compliance and security posture.
  • •Collaborate with software development and product teams to learn how security is integrated into the software development lifecycle and secure coding practices.

Key Requirements

  • •Must have earned a Master's degree in Cybersecurity, Computer Science, Information Systems, Computer Engineering, Engineering, or a related technical field before the full-time start date.
  • •Student graduation date must be between December 2027 and June 2028.
  • •Foundational understanding of cybersecurity, information security, application security, network security, cloud security, or technology risk concepts.
  • •Foundational knowledge of network protocols and security fundamentals including IAM, data privacy/protection, or secure software development.
  • •Interest in scripting/automation using languages such as Python, Bash, PowerShell (or similar) and strong communication and learning agility.
